body {margin: 0px auto; padding: 0px; background-color: #F6F6F6; color: #000000; font-family: Verdana, Arial, sans-serif; /*Arial,Helvetica;*/ font-size: 12px;}
a {text-decoration: none;}
.center {border: 1px solid #ddd; background:white; padding:5px; box-shadow: 0px 2px 4px rgba(0, 0, 0, 0.3);}
.cbalink {display:none;}

.bewem {border-color: #777 transparent;
border-style: solid;
border-width: 4px 4px 0 4px; height: 0;
width: 0; top: 10px;}

.subway {width: 16px; height: 16px; background: url('images/google16.png') -32px 0;}
.ico16-13-home {width: 16px; height: 16px; background: url('images/google16.png') 0 -96px;}
.ico16-13-discover {width: 16px; height: 16px; background: url('images/google16.png') -16px -96px;}
.ico16-13-profile {width: 16px; height: 16px; background: url('images/google16.png') -32px -96px;}
.ico16-13-messages {width: 16px; height: 16px; background: url('images/google16.png') -48px -96px;}
.ico16-13-circles {width: 16px; height: 16px; background: url('images/google16.png') -64px -96px;}
.ico16-13-communities {width: 16px; height: 16px; background: url('images/google16.png') -80px -96px;}
.ico16-13-event {width: 16px; height: 16px; background: url('images/google16.png') -96px -96px;}
.ico16-13-community {width: 16px; height: 16px; background: url('images/google16.png') -112px -96px;}
.ico16-13-photo {width: 16px; height: 16px; background: url('images/google16.png') -128px -96px;}
.ico16-13-colect {width: 16px; height: 16px; background: url('images/google16.png') -144px -96px;}
.ico16-13-pages {width: 16px; height: 16px; background: url('images/google16.png') -160px -96px;}
.ico16-13-more {width: 16px; height: 16px; background: url('images/google16.png') -176px -96px;}
.ico16-13-games {width: 16px; height: 16px; background: url('images/google16.png') -192px -96px;}
.ico16-13-local {width: 16px; height: 16px; background: url('images/google16.png') -208px -96px;}
.menutext {margin: -18px 20px;}

.arrow-right, .arrow-left, .arrow-up, .arrow-down {
  border: solid black;
  border-width: 0 3px 3px 0;
  display: inline-block;
  padding: 3px;
}

.arrow-right {
  transform: rotate(-45deg);
  -webkit-transform: rotate(-45deg);
}

.arrow-left {
  transform: rotate(135deg);
  -webkit-transform: rotate(135deg);
}

.arrow-up {
  transform: rotate(-135deg);
  -webkit-transform: rotate(-135deg);
}

.arrow-down {
  transform: rotate(45deg);
  -webkit-transform: rotate(45deg);
}


nav {color: #000000; background: #FFFFFF; text-align: left; font-size: 36px; font-weight: bold; width: 100%; margin: auto; box-shadow: 0px 2px 8px rgba(127, 127, 127, 0.5); height: 48px; position: relative;}
nav {display: -webkit-flex; display: flex; -webkit-justify-content: space-between; justify-content: space-between;}/*background-color: lightgrey; | flex-start*/
/*nav .left, nav .center, nav .right {background-color: cornflowerblue; width: 100px; height: 100px; margin: 10px;}*/
nav #left {text-align: left; display: inline-block;}
nav .logo {text-align: center; background: #EA0603; width: 48px; height: 48px;}
nav .logo a {color: #FFFFFF;}
nav .select {text-align: center; background: #EAEAEA; width: 96px; height: 32px; font-size: 28px; border-radius: 4px; margin: -41px 60px; color: #000000;}
/*nav #center {text-align: left;}*/
nav #right {text-align: right; float: right;}
nav .share {text-align: center; background: #EAEAEA; width: 32px; height: 32px; font-size: 28px; border-radius: 4px; margin: 6px -120px; color: #000000;}
nav .nots {text-align: center; background: #EAEAEA; width: 32px; height: 32px; font-size: 28px; border-radius: 4px; margin: -40px -80px; color: #000000;}
nav .account {text-align: center; background: #EAEAEA; width: 32px; height: 32px; font-size: 28px; border-radius: 4px; margin: 6px -40px; color: #000000;}

#navbox {height: 100%; width: 196px; position: fixed; box-shadow: 0px 2px 8px rgba(127, 127, 127, 0.5); font-weight:bold; background: #FFFFFF;
  z-index: 3;}/*background: #E2ECF5;*/
#navbox a {color: #000000; font-size: 1.5em; margin: 10px;}
#navbox #link {margin: 0 15px;}
#navbox #line {border-bottom: 1px solid #C8C8C8; padding-top: 20px;}

#wrapper {font: 12px Arial, Helvetica, sans-serif; margin: auto; padding-top: 10px; max-width: 1000px;}
.post h1, .post h2, .post h3 {
	font: 1.82em;
	font-weight: normal;
	font-family: Arial, Helvetica, sans-serif;
	color: #000000;
}
.post {font: 12px Arial, Helvetica, sans-serif; margin: auto; padding-top: 20px; max-width: 1000px;}
.center {background:white; padding:5px;}
.newbox {border: 1px solid #C8C8C8; /*gray/#ddd dashed*/ box-shadow: 0px 1px 3px rgba(127, 127, 127, 0.4);}
.status {background: #0084ff; padding: 6px; border-radius: 5px; font-weight: bold; color: #fff; width: 200px; margin: auto;}

@media all and (min-width:1000px) {
  /*.mini {display:none;}*/
.mobile {display:none;}
.full {width: 1000px; margin: auto;}
.content
{ background-color: #FBFBFB;
	width: 1000px;/*986px;970px*/
	margin-right: auto; margin-left: auto; margin-top: 20px; margin-bottom: 20px;
	text-align: center;
	padding-top: 50px;
	padding-bottom: 50px;
	font: 18px Lato, sans-serif;
  z-index: 2;
}
.content h1 {font-size: 40px; font-weight: bold;}
.content h2 {font-size: 31px;}
.point {margin-right: auto; margin-left: auto; display: inline-block; padding-top: 20px;}
.graph {width: 496px; height: 200px; font: 18px Lato, sans-serif; display: inline-block;}
.point1 {width: 496px; height: 200px; margin-left: auto; font: 18px Lato, sans-serif; display: inline-block; text-align: left;}
.point1 h1 {text-align: left;}
.point2 {width: 496px; height: 200px; margin-right: auto; font: 18px Lato, sans-serif; display: inline-block; text-align: right;}
.point2 h1 {text-align: right;}
}

@media all and (max-width:999px) { /*761px*/
.full {display:none;}
#navbox {opacity: 0.9;}
.content {width: 100%; height: 100%; margin-right: auto; margin-left: auto; margin-top: 20px; margin-bottom: 20px; text-align: center; border: 1px solid grey; border-left: none; border-right: none; font: 18px Lato, sans-serif; z-index: 2;}
.content h1 {font-size: 40px; font-weight: bold;}
.content h2 {font-size: 31px;}
.point {margin-right: auto; margin-left: auto; display: inline-block; padding-top: 20px;}
.graph {width: 496px; height: 200px; font: 18px Lato, sans-serif; display: inline-block;}
.point1 {width: 496px; height: 200px; margin-left: auto; font: 18px Lato, sans-serif; display: inline-block; text-align: left;}
.point1 h1 {text-align: left;}
.point2 {width: 496px; height: 200px; margin-right: auto; font: 18px Lato, sans-serif; display: inline-block; text-align: right;}
.point2 h1 {text-align: right;}
.square {width: 100%; margin: auto; text-align: center; border: 1px solid grey; font: 18px Lato, sans-serif; background: #f2f2f2; margin-top: 1%; margin-bottom: 1%; padding: 20px 0;}
.square h1 {font-size: 30px; font-weight: bold;}
.square h2 {font-size: 21px;}
  /*#lewy, #srodek, #prawy {float:none; width:auto; margin:15px;}*/
}

.container {min-height:100%;}
.sub-green {border-radius: 6px; cursor: pointer; margin: 0; text-align: center; /*border: 1px solid silver; border-color: #CCCCCC #AAAAAA #999999;*/ border: 0; background-image: -webkit-linear-gradient(#31aa3f, #21962f); background-image: linear-gradient(#31aa3f, #21962f); background-color: #318d3c; color: white; padding: 4px 5px; box-shadow: 0px 0.4px 1px rgba(0, 0, 0, 0.3);}

#footer {background-color: #EEEEEE; min-height: 40px; overflow: hidden; width: 100%; border-top: 1px solid rgba(0,0,0,0.13);}
#footer {display: -webkit-flex; display: flex; -webkit-justify-content: space-between; justify-content: space-between;}
#footer .left {text-align: left;}
#footer .right {text-align: right; float: right;}
